The Story
Caroline was a 32-year-old middle school teacher who suffered from brain pain, memory loss, and vision problems. Doctors diagnosed her with early onset dementia and Alzheimer's in early 2016. She then had a stroke on April 16, 2016, and entered the hospital. During an MRI scan the next day, she had her near-death experience. She left her body and felt stretched upward into dark space with pretty energies. She pleaded she was not ready to leave Earth. A voice said, 'No, you're not.' Big hands grabbed her ankles and pulled her back. They peeled off a blue layer of her old self. She received downloads about a new purpose in health and healing, rewriting life contracts, training with a woman doctor, and writing books. The MRI machine shut down. After the NDE, Caroline lost her passion for teaching children but gained a strong drive to help people heal from chronic illnesses like Lyme disease, which she later discovered she had. She moved to Vermont, trained with a naturopathic doctor, wrote a book called 'From Lyme Delight' about her journey and healing tools, and now works as a medical intuitive to promote compassion, awareness, and energy-based healing for others.
This NDE features an out-of-body experience during a stroke-related unconsciousness in an MRI machine, with claims of viewing one's own body from above and a machine malfunction upon return, but lacks specific, verifiable details about external events or people that could not have been accessed normally. No independent verifications or timely pre-verification reports are provided, limiting evidential strength.
